Residual bending moment in tensile specimens greatly affects time-to-failure in high temperature tensile creep tests of advanced silicon nitride. Advanced design of fixtures and specimens is therefore required to improve the accuracy. Self-alignment abilities in several types of specimens were evaluated in terms of the absolute values of residual bending moment. It was found that bending moment in thickness direction is greatly improved by rounding the side surfaces of specimens while the improvement in the width direction was very slight.
